From: Koutian Wu via GitGitGadget @ 2026-06-15 7:53 UTC (permalink / raw)
To: git; +Cc: Koutian Wu, Koutian Wu
From: Koutian Wu <ktwu01@gmail.com>
The *.pl pattern currently sets eof=lf, which is not a built-in
attribute used for line-ending normalization.
Use eol=lf instead, matching the neighboring *.perl and *.pm rules, so
Perl scripts are checked out with LF line endings.
Signed-off-by: Koutian Wu <ktwu01@gmail.com>

This typo come from 1f34e0cd (.gitattributes: include `text`
attribute for eol attributes, 2023-02-03), that added "text" to
those entries with eol=lf, which inherited from 20460635
(.gitattributes: use the "perl" differ for Perl, 2018-04-26), which
inherited it while it was adding diff=perl from 00acdbc6
(.gitattributes: add *.pl extension for Perl, 2018-04-26) that added
the .pl pattern. It is interesting that nobody seems to have
noticed the typo during the reviews of these three patches that
touched these lines ;-).
